Canterbury Cathedral on World Polio Day

Lovely to see Canterbury Cathedral’s Corona lit up purple for the global #purple4polio campaign to raise awareness about polio.

Rotary has been working to eradicate polio for over 30 years, and the goal of ridding the earth of this disease is in sight. It started in 1979 with vaccinations for 6 million children in the Philippines. Today, Afghanistan, Nigeria, and Pakistan are the only countries where polio remains endemic. https://www.endpolio.org/what-is-polio#Facts
